Sorry, there was a problem. Please try again later.Thanks for your question. Active noise cancelation works best on consistent noises like the drone of airplane engines. Sharp or high pitched sounds may be attenuated to some extent, but the QC35 are not designed to eliminate all sound. Best regards, -Emmet Bose Support
